In 2022, the Moreton Bay Triathlon and Moreton Bay Running Festival will combine to become a mega weekend of sport for the Moreton Bay Multisport Festival.
Bring your whole crew along to enjoy the perfect twilight running conditions and cooler evening temperatures on the gorgeous Moreton Bay foreshore. Distances available for all running (and walking) abilities.
The race is a lapped course starting and finishing at Pelican Park.
Half Marathon starts at 3:30pm
10km and 5km both start 4:15pm
1.5km starts 5:15pm
Make a weekend of it and take on one of our Moreton Bay Triathlon events the morning after your run. With distances from kids and beginners right through to the seasoned pros, there’s certainly something for everyone.
Held at the Pelican Park on the beautiful Moreton Bay foreshore – this is such a great location for a triathlon and the Moreton Bay Triathlon is a race not to be missed. This event features a safe swim in the protected bay, followed by a fast ride over the Ted Smout Bridge and a flat foreshore run.
Triathlon Event categories
Classic 15years+
Swim 2000m/2 laps | Cycle 60km/6 laps | Run 15km/2 laps
Club 14years+
Swim 1000m/1 lap | Cycle 30km/3 laps | Run 7.5km/ 1 lap
Enticer 12years+
Swim 300m/1 lap | Cycle 10km/1 lap | Run 2.5km/1 lap
Kool Kids - non-competitive 7-14years
Swim 100m/ 1 lap | Cycle 2km/ 1 lap | Run 500m/1 lap
When: 14-15th May 2022
Where: Pelican Park, 101 Hornibrook Esplanade, Clontarf
Who: For serious athletes and newbies of varying fitness levels. Ages 7 and up.
